Highlighting Malayalam Films and Mrinal Sen’s Works at Thiruvananthapuram Film Festival

Upcoming Film Festival in Thiruvananthapuram

A total of 12 Malayalam films, each based on thought-provoking themes such as individuals, suicide, body, identity and hope, are set to be showcased at the upcoming film festival in Thiruvananthapuram.

Highlights from the Lineup

  • O.Baby: An action drama thriller film directed by Ranjan Pramod.
  • Kathal The Core: A hit film starring Mammootty and Jyotika, produced by Jio Baby and scripted by Paulson Skaria-Adarsh​​​​​​Sukumaran team.
  • Attam: Directed by Anand Ekarshi.
  • Waiting for Death: A film by Satish Babasenan, Santhosh Babasenan Ana Mona Lisa.
  • Sheherazada: A film directed by Vignesh P. Sasidharan.
  • Ennen: Directed by Shalini Ushadevi.
  • Neelmudi’s film: Directed by V. Sarathkumar.
  • B32 to 44: A film directed by Shruti Saranyam.
  • Five First Dates: Directed by Renoshan.
  • Apple Pattali: Directed by Gagan Dev.
  • Dayam: Directed by Prashant Vijay.
  • Valasai Paravas: Directed by Sunil Malur.

Mrinal Sen Birth Centenary Film Festival

In commemorating Mrinal Sen’s birth centenary, the film festival will also feature five of his iconic films, including Regards, Bhuvan Shome, Calcutta 71, Ek Din Prati Din, and Ekaler Shantane.

An exhibition showcasing the life and works of Mrinal Sen will be organized at the Tagore Theatre, offering attendees a glimpse into the legendary filmmaker’s legacy.
